Q: What is a Series Limited Liability Company?A: A Series Limited Liability Company is a special type of limited liability company (LLC) in Kansas that allows for the creation of separate series or divisions within the company, each with its own assets, liabilities, and members.
Q: What is an Annual Report?A: An Annual Report is a document that certain types of businesses, including LC50 Limited Liability Companies and Series Limited Liability Companies, are required to file with the state of Kansas on a yearly basis. Q: What information is included in an Annual Report for an LC50 or Series Limited Liability Company?A: The Annual Report for an LC50 or Series Limited Liability Company typically includes details about the company's name, principal place of business, registered agent, members, and any changes to these details throughout the year.
Q: When is the deadline to file an Annual Report for an LC50 or Series Limited Liability Company in Kansas?A: The deadline to file the Annual Report for an LC50 or Series Limited Liability Company in Kansas is generally April 15th each year.
Q: Are there any filing fees for the Annual Report of an LC50 or Series Limited Liability Company in Kansas?A: Yes, there are filing fees associated with the Annual Report for an LC50 or Series Limited Liability Company in Kansas. The exact fees may vary.
Q: What happens if I don't file the Annual Report for my LC50 or Series Limited Liability Company?A: Failure to file the Annual Report for an LC50 or Series Limited Liability Company in Kansas may result in penalties, such as late fees or the loss of good standing status.
